SOME SUGGESTIONS AND INFORMATION ABOUT TRAVELLING

1. PASSPORTS AND VISAS

(a) If visiting foreign countries ensure that your passport is valid and that you have a valid visa, where necessary, for the countries to be visited.

(b) If you lose your passport, notify your nearest Consulate.

(c) If you and your family are on a joint passport and intend to travel separately but at the same time; separate passports must be obtained.

2. CURRENCY AND EXCHANGE

Traveller's checks are one of the safest methods of carrying money. These can be obtained from your bank or travel agents and are signed once when issued and again when cashed.

Alternatively a letter of credit can be opened on which sums can be drawn.

Many countries have forms of exchange control limiting the amounts of currency taken in and out of their borders. It is wise to check with your bank about the countries you propose to visit.
